At Rivermont Schools, we serve students with emotional, behavioral, and developmental challenges through individualized education and therapeutic support. Our values of compassion, collaboration, and growth guide everything we do. Join us in helping students achieve their highest potential.

As the Principal at Rivermont Schools, you’ll provide leadership and vision that foster academic excellence, positive school culture, and student success. You’ll oversee daily operations, support a dedicated team of educators and clinicians, and ensure the school meets all academic, behavioral, and therapeutic standards that define Rivermont’s mission.

What You'll Need

  • Master’s degree in special education, school administration, or a related field

  • At least 3 years of experience working with students with disabilities

  • Eligibility for or possession of a valid VDOE postgraduate professional license with endorsement in administration and supervision or special education

  • Proven leadership, organizational, and communication skills to manage teams and ensure compliance

  • Valid Virginia driver’s license

What You'll Do

  • Lead daily school operations, ensuring compliance with VDOE regulations, accreditation standards, and Rivermont policies

  • Supervise and support staff in delivering high-quality academic and therapeutic programming

  • Oversee curriculum implementation, student assessment, and individualized treatment planning

  • Maintain accurate records, monitor service quality, and ensure accountability for student outcomes

  • Foster positive relationships with students, families, staff, and community partners to strengthen engagement and collaboration
